php 怎么设置新页面打开

不及物动词 其他 180

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在PHP中,我们可以使用target属性来设置链接的打开方式。target属性有以下几种取值:

    1. _blank:在新窗口中打开链接。
    2. _self:在当前窗口中打开链接。
    3. _parent:在父级窗口中打开链接。
    4. _top:在整个窗口中打开链接,忽略所有的框架。

    要在PHP中设置链接的打开方式,可以使用标签的target属性来实现。以下是具体的代码示例:

    “`
    点击这里,在新窗口中打开链接
    “`

    在上面的代码中,我们通过设置target=”_blank”来实现在新窗口中打开链接。你可以将”https://www.example.com”替换为你要打开的链接。

    同样地,你也可以将target属性的值设置为其他的取值,以实现不同的打开方式。例如:

    “`
    点击这里,在当前窗口中打开链接
    点击这里,在父级窗口中打开链接
    点击这里,在整个窗口中打开链接
    “`

    在实际应用中,你可以根据你的需求选择合适的打开方式来设置链接的target属性。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    如何设置新页面在 PHP中打开?

    在 PHP 中,想要设置新页面打开,可以使用如下方法:

    1. 使用HTML标签
    可以在 PHP 脚本中使用 HTML 标签来设置新页面打开。在需要打开新页面的链接或按钮上添加 “target=_blank” 属性即可。例如:

    “`html
    点击这里打开新页面
    “`

    2. 使用 JavaScript
    可以使用 JavaScript 来设置新页面打开。通过在 PHP 文件中嵌入 JavaScript 代码,可以在链接中添加 “window.open” 方法,将链接的目标设置为 “_blank”。例如:

    “`php
    window.open(“newpage.php”, “_blank”);‘;
    ?>
    “`

    3. 使用 PHP 的 header 函数
    PHP 提供了 header 函数用来发送 HTTP 头,通过使用 header 函数,可以设置新页面打开。例如:

    “`php

    “`

    这将向浏览器发送一个重定向的 HTTP 头,告诉浏览器打开名为 “newpage.php” 的新页面。

    4. 使用 AJAX
    可以使用 AJAX 技术来异步加载并打开新页面。在 PHP 中,可以通过编写 JavaScript 代码来使用 AJAX,从而实现打开新页面的效果。例如:

    “`javascript
    function openNewPage() {
    var xhttp = new XMLHttpRequest();
    xhttp.onreadystatechange = function() {
    if (this.readyState == 4 && this.status == 200) {
    window.open(“newpage.php”, “_blank”);
    }
    };
    xhttp.open(“GET”, “newpage.php”, true);
    xhttp.send();
    }
    “`

    在 HTML 中调用该函数,就可以实现点击按钮或链接时异步加载并打开新页面。

    5. 使用第三方库
    除了自己编写代码以外,也可以使用一些第三方库来帮助实现新页面打开的效果。例如,可以使用 Bootstrap 框架中的模态框(Modal)组件,在点击按钮或链接时打开一个模态框,达到类似的效果。

    总结:
    以上是在 PHP 中设置新页面打开的几种方法。根据具体的需求和开发环境,选择适合的方法来实现新页面打开的效果。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在PHP中,我们可以使用多种方法来设置新页面的打开。下面将从方法、操作流程等方面来详细讲解如何设置新页面的打开。

    方法一:使用target属性
    最常用的方法是使用HTML中的target属性来设置新页面的打开。我们可以通过给链接或表单添加target属性来指定链接的打开方式。

    1. 链接方式:
    在HTML中,通过“`“`标签来创建超链接。我们可以为“`“`标签添加target属性,并将其值设置为”_blank”来在新页面中打开链接。

    “`html
    点击这里在新页面中打开链接
    “`

    2. 表单方式:
    在HTML中,通常使用“`

    “`标签来创建表单。同样地,我们可以为“`
    “`标签添加target属性,并将其值设置为”_blank”来在新页面中打开表单。

    “`html


    “`

    方法二:使用JavaScript
    除了使用HTML的target属性,我们还可以使用JavaScript来设置新页面的打开。通过使用“`window.open()“`方法,我们可以在JavaScript中动态地打开新的浏览器窗口或选项卡。

    1. 使用window.open()方法:
    在JavaScript中,我们可以使用“`window.open()“`方法来打开新页面。该方法接受三个参数:url(打开的页面URL),target(打开方式,如”_blank”)、height(窗口高度)和width(窗口宽度)等。

    “`javascript
    window.open(“new_page.php”, “_blank”);
    “`

    当我们在PHP中使用JavaScript时,可以直接嵌入JavaScript代码或通过PHP输出JavaScript代码:

    “`php
    echo ““;
    “`

    操作流程:
    1. 在你的PHP页面中,确定要设置新页面打开的链接或表单。
    2. 使用HTML的“`target“`属性或JavaScript的“`window.open()“`方法来设置链接或表单的打开方式。
    3. 在HTML中添加“`target=”_blank”“`属性或在JavaScript中使用“`window.open()“`方法。
    4. 运行你的PHP页面并点击链接或提交表单,将会在新的浏览器窗口或选项卡中打开目标页面。

    以上就是通过PHP设置新页面打开的方法和操作流程。根据你的需求,你可以选择使用HTML的target属性或JavaScript的window.open()方法来实现新页面的打开。希望这个解答对你有所帮助!

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部